On Jul 28, 2016 2:41 AM, "Pohjolainen, Topi" <topi.pohjolai...@intel.com> wrote: > > On Tue, Jul 26, 2016 at 03:02:16PM -0700, Jason Ekstrand wrote: > > The sampling hardware can handle them ok. It just looks at the tiling to > > determine whether it's the new gen9 1-D layout or the old one. The render > > hardware isn't so smart. > > To clarify, this is not needed at this point but prepares for the upcoming > patches (i.e, prevents regression there)?
Yup.
